texte = --00148531a4a2554f1a0474593df3 Content-Type: text/plain; charset=UTF-8 Hi all, I'm starting to make the move to CentOS 5 from OSX and having great fun getting my head around permissions. I just want to check that my assumptions are correct and then ask a couple of questions: From the list it would appear that the correct permissions are: directories : 770 dbs (secure files) : 660 non-secure files : 644 One problem I am having though is that my FTP client (Fetch) can't modify sub-folders created by WebDNA. I.e. I can't rename or delete a folder titled '09' within a folder titled '2009' - both created by WebDNA. On the good side the speed test on the new server is coming out at 182 compared to 483 on the old OSX server. - Tom --00148531a4a2554f1a0474593df3 Content-Type: text/html; charset=UTF-8 Content-Transfer-Encoding: quoted-printable Hi all,
